Warn re: Axes3D constructor behavior change in mpl3.4 #18939

According togit bisect,261f706 by@anntzer broke the following code, adapted from the examples -- it produces a blank / empty plot:

from mpl_toolkits.mplot3d import Axes3Dimport matplotlib.pyplot as pltimport numpy as npfig = plt.figure()ax = Axes3D(fig)# ax = fig.gca(projection='3d')X = np.arange(-5, 5, 0.25)Y = np.arange(-5, 5, 0.25)X, Y = np.meshgrid(X, Y)R = np.sqrt(X**2 + Y**2)Z = np.sin(R)surf = ax.plot_surface(X, Y, Z)

If you comment out theax = Axes3D(fig) line and useax = fig.gca(projection='3d'), it works fine. It also works fine on the preceding commit34f99a9.
